What's the difference between ceramic fuses and glass cartridge fuses?
The main difference between ceramic and glass fuses is their durability. Ceramic options, like this one, have higher breaking capacities, making them a better fit for industrial settings where loads are likely to be high.
Can I reset this fuse?
No, this is a sacrificial element, so if it blows, you'll need to replace it immediately to keep your system protected.
